Pub
The is a grade II listed public house in , Norfolk, England. It was designed by A. W. Ecclestone in the Art Deco and Streamline Moderne styles and built in 1956 as a memorial to the nine lifeboatmen who died in the Caister lifeboat disaster of 1901. is situated 1,700 feet northeast of VIP Market.
